This data is provided as an additional tool in helping to insure edition identification: ++++"Three physico-theological discourses ... wherein are largely discussed the production and use of mountains, the original of fountains, of formed stones, and sea-fishes bones and shells found in the earth"Ray, John, 1627-1705.[Edition statement: ] The second edition corrected, very much enlarged, and illustrated with copper plates.Advertisement on p. [2] at end.[Contents note]: (from t.p.) I. The primitive chaos and creation of the world -- II. The general deluge, its causes and effects -- III. The dissolution of the world and future conflagration.[32], 406, [2] p., [4] leaves of plates: London: Printed for Sam. Smith ..., Arber's Term cat. / II 429Wing / R409EnglishReproduction of the original in the Cambridge University Library++++This book represents an authentic reproduction of the text as printed by the original publisher.
